Who are we?

Plotly is the Montreal-based company behind the wildly-popular open-source Dash analytical app framework for Python, R and Julia and the open-source Plotly Graphing Libraries for Javascript, Python, R, Julia, and .NET. We are an open-core company, and our commercial product, based on Dash, is Dash Enterprise.

How does sponsorship work?

Beyond contributing to the success of our open-source project by using them, publicizing them, discussing them on our community forum, reporting bugs or working directly on the documentation or code, you can contribute financially to these projects via Github Sponsors.

Each of our repositories has certain issues marked ❤️ Needs Spon$or and these issues are prioritized on our product development roadmap according to how much funding they have accumulated from sponsors: the issues with the most accumulated sponsorship will be worked on next. We’ll update “Needs Spon$or” issue comments with which issue has the most funding and is currently being addressed, so the community knows where we are in the queue. We currently employ a small number of full-time developers who work to address the issues most needed by the community, in the order of their accumulated sponsorship amount, but otherwise do not benefit Dash Enterprise or have a business case for Plotly. Some of these issues have sat for years with no clear line of sight to funding, so we’re excited to institute this funding system to be able to hire additional developers for sponsor-prioritized issues as funding allows.

Once you become a sponsor, please indicate which issue you would like to direct your sponsorship towards in a comment on that issue, so that everyone in the community can see how much funding these issues are receiving. If you would prefer to do this anonymously, please email adam@plotly.com and we will add this note ourselves without identifying you.

Please note that sponsorships are non-refundable and that all contributions go towards funding developer time to work on sponsor-prioritized issues.
